High MCV: what a raised MCV means

A high MCV means your red blood cells are on average larger than normal, usually above 100 fl. The medical term is macrocytosis. Of every value in your blood count, this is the one you can least wave away with "I trained hard yesterday", because training barely changes your MCV.

That is exactly what makes it valuable.

Where your haemoglobin and your white cells swing around with your training schedule, your MCV sits there fairly unmoved. If it is high, there is usually another reason. And that reason is worth chasing.

What is a normal MCV value?

Most Dutch labs use roughly 80 to 100 fl (femtolitres) as the reference. Below 80 your cells are called microcytic, above 100 macrocytic. MCV stands for mean corpuscular volume. Unlike MCH it is not a calculation: modern cell counters measure the volume of each red blood cell directly and report the mean. Your haematocrit is what gets calculated from it, as MCV times your red blood cell count.

Always read the range on your own result, because labs differ.

And do not read the MCV alone. It only becomes informative next to your haemoglobin and your MCH.

What does an MCV of 89, 92 or 97 mean?

All three are normal, and that is not the whole answer. The middle of the reference band sits higher than most people assume, so a reading of 89 fl or 92 fl is not a borderline value you just get away with. It is roughly where the average adult sits.

That is because the median MCV climbs slowly with age. In an analysis of 977,335 measurements from people without anaemia at a single South Korean hospital, the median was 89.9 fl between 20 and 29, 91.2 fl between 40 and 49, and 93.0 fl above eighty (PMID 35599236). The middle half of the twenty-somethings fell between 87.4 and 92.5 fl, and of the forty-somethings between 88.5 and 93.9 fl. So an MCV of 89 fl is almost exactly the median in your twenties, 90 fl or 92 fl is ordinary mid-range in your forties, and 94 fl and 97 fl sit in the upper half of normal rather than outside it.

Your MCV (fl)What it is calledWhat it usually means
below 80microcyticsmaller cells; iron deficiency is the most common explanation, and ferritin is the next value
80 to 90normocytic, lower endnormal, but low in the band; with symptoms alongside, your iron status is the logical follow-up
90 to 98normocytic, middlenormal; this is where most adults sit, and the share grows with age
98 to 100normocytic, upper endstill normal; it only gets interesting above 100
above 100macrocyticlarger cells; alcohol, vitamin B12 and folate are the first questions

A number from that table is not a diagnosis, and a shift within the band often says more than the position itself. Going from 88 to 97 fl in a year is a change, even though both readings stay comfortably normal. Why a normal MCV does not rule out a deficiency

This is the most important pitfall of the value, and it sits in the word average. If you have an iron deficiency and a vitamin B12 or folate deficiency at the same time, your bone marrow makes both undersized and oversized cells. In the average they cancel out. Your MCV lands neatly on 90 fl while two deficiencies exist side by side.

Your RDW does give it away. The MCV gives you the average, the RDW gives you the spread around it. A normal MCV with a clearly raised RDW is exactly the pattern a combined deficiency produces, which is why those two values should never be read apart.

In practice: if you are tired without an obvious reason and your MCV is normal, that on its own is not reassurance. Having ferritin, vitamin B12 and folate measured alongside it tells you more than looking at the same average again.

What causes a high MCV?

In Dutch general practice the two best known causes are alcohol and a deficiency of vitamin B12 or folate. Research among Dutch primary care patients with macrocytic anaemia found exactly that pattern: a shortage of B12 or folate and excessive alcohol use are among the most common explanations (PMID 27542607).

Alcohol enlarges your red cells even without a vitamin deficiency. It is a direct effect on your bone marrow, and one of the earliest traces drinking leaves in your blood.

Possible causeWhat you often see alongsideWhat you want measured with it
Regular alcohol useMCV mildly to moderately raised, sometimes raised gamma-GTLiver values
Vitamin B12 deficiencyMCV high, sometimes tingling or fatigueVitamin B12
Folate deficiencyA picture similar to B12Folate
Underactive thyroidMCV mildly raised, tiredness, cold intoleranceTSH
Liver diseaseRaised liver valuesALT, AST, gamma-GT
Certain medicinesAn isolated raised MCVBring your medication list

A raised MCV without anaemia is common, and not automatically alarming. Research among middle-aged and older adults found that macrocytosis is by no means always linked to a vitamin deficiency (PMID 24244281).

Why is a high MCV in athletes a reason to look further?

Because the usual sporting explanation does not apply here. With your haemoglobin, haematocrit and white cells you can often attribute a deviation to dilution or to yesterday session. With your MCV you cannot: it barely moves with your training schedule.

That makes a raised MCV in an athlete relatively more informative than in anyone else. There is less noise to cross out.

Take a strength athlete with an MCV of 103 fl, a normal haemoglobin and otherwise fine values. There is no training explanation. There are, however, three glasses of wine an evening, or a plant-based diet without B12 supplementation. Those are the questions that belong on the table.

I watch athletes panic over a haemoglobin that dropped through dilution, and look straight past an MCV of 104. That is exactly the wrong order.

Can a high MCV be harmful?

The MCV itself is not a disease; it is a clue. Large red cells usually do their job perfectly well, and many people with a mildly raised MCV notice nothing at all. What sits underneath it may deserve treatment, which is why a raised value is a reason to look further rather than to ignore.

A B12 deficiency that persists for a long time can cause nerve symptoms, for instance. That is not something to sit out.

The NHG guideline on anaemia describes macrocytosis as a finding that calls for an explanation. Not as a diagnosis, but not as noise either.

When should you discuss a raised MCV with your GP?

Almost always, and certainly if it stays above 100 fl on a repeat measurement. This is the value in your blood count I would take least lightly. Especially combined with fatigue, tingling in hands or feet, or if you drink regularly.

Take your whole blood count with you, and your medication list. An isolated raised MCV calls for a different route than a raised MCV with anaemia alongside it (PMID 17619679).

And be honest about your drinking. Your MCV has already been honest about it.

What is a good MCV value?

Between 80 and 100 fl, and within that band most adults sit in the upper half. In a large South Korean hospital dataset the median rose with age: around 89.9 fl in your twenties and 93.0 fl above eighty. A reading of 92 or 94 is therefore not a borderline value but ordinary mid-range. Always check the reference printed on your own result, because labs differ from one another.

What does a high MCV value mean?

Above 100 fl your red blood cells are called macrocytic: they are larger than normal on average. In Dutch general practice alcohol and a vitamin B12 or folate deficiency top the list, with thyroid, liver and certain medicines behind them. It is a clue, not a diagnosis. A repeat measurement with your B12 alongside it usually gives direction quickly.

What does it mean if your MCH is high?

MCH is the amount of haemoglobin per red blood cell, and it often moves with your MCV, because larger cells hold more haemoglobin. A raised MCH therefore usually points the same way as a raised MCV, towards vitamin B12, folate or alcohol. What does MCV stand for in a blood test?

MCV stands for mean corpuscular volume, the average volume of a single red blood cell, expressed in femtolitres (fl). Modern cell counters measure the volume of each red blood cell directly and report the mean; your haematocrit is calculated from that instead. It comes as standard with a complete blood count, alongside MCH, MCHC and RDW, so it costs you no extra tube of blood.

Is an MCV of 104 something to worry about?

An MCV of 104 fl sits just above the reference and is called mildly macrocytic. On its own that says little: many people with this value notice nothing, and a tube left standing for a day already produces an artificially higher MCV. What counts is the rest of your blood count and whether a repeat measurement stays there. Discuss it with your GP.

How long does a raised MCV take to fall after you stop drinking?

Slowly, because you cannot speed up the cells you already have. Red blood cells live around 120 days and your MCV falls at roughly that pace, so expect weeks up to about three months before the value is back to normal. Do not remeasure after a fortnight and draw a conclusion from it. A check at three months tells you more.
